**Shop Service Technician Helper Responsibilities**:
Stocks; places orders; verifies receipt of parts and supplies for service technicians

Assists service technicians and other service drive employees by bringing appropriate supplies and equipment to workspace and then putting away after use

Performs basic vehicle maintenance services including but not limited rotating, replacing, mounting and balancing tires, adjusting fluids and coolants, oil and filter changes and brake adjustments

Cleans work areas, empties trash, collects scrap and used materials then process according to company policy and in accordance with local, state and federal regulations

Moves vehicles from one area to another within the dealership

Cleans vehicles prior to delivery to customer

Performs additional duties related to the repair of vehicles as required and assigned by senior technician or Supervisors

Documents all work performed

Maintains and wears all required safety and health personal protective equipment, including respirator, in the manner recommended by the equipment manufacturer and in accordance with company policies

Complies with all laws and regulations pertaining to working with hazardous materials.

Reports any deviations to management immediately

Communicates with Supervisor if additional work is needed
